
The atmosphere at Eden Gardens was nothing short of electric as it was on Sunday evening Kolkata Knight Riders (KKR) hosted Rajasthan Royals (RR) In his 28th match IPL 2026 season. In a match that swung like a pendulum, KKR won by 4 wickets with 2 balls to spare and snatched victory from the jaws of defeat. It was ice-cold as the bowlers set the scene Rinku Singh and an explosive cameo Anukul Roy This infuriated the Kolkata faithful.
A disciplined KKR restrict RR to a modest total in the first innings
Winning the toss and preferring the trophy, Ajinkya Rahane‘s KKR RR faced an early onslaught from the openers. Young sensation Vaibhav Suryavanshi Looked dangerous hitting 46 off 28 balls including four boundaries and two powerful sixes. Next to it Yashasvi Jaiswal (29 off 39), RR reach 63/0 in Powerplay. 81/0 in the 9th over, a total of 190 north looked inevitable.
However, KKR’s introduction of Spin Twins brought the scoring rate down completely. Varun Chakraborty produced a masterclass in mystery bowling, finishing with stunning figures of 3/14 in 4 overs. He fired Suryavanshi and dangerous, leading to a downfall Dhruv Jurel in rapid succession.
Sunil Narine Taking 2/26 provided the perfect cushion from the other end. RR’s middle order collapsed under the pressure of dot balls; Rian Parag (12) and Shimron Hetmyer (15) could not find a fence. Karthik Tyagi cleared the tail with a three-wicket haul in the death overs. From a position of absolute strength, Rajasthan were restricted to a modest 155/9, managing just 55 runs in the last 10 overs.
Rinku Singh and Anukul Roy lead KKR to a thrilling win against T RR in IPL 2026
The pursuit began disastrously for the Purple Men. Jofra Archer Tim Seifert was dismissed for a golden duck in the first ball and skipper Rahane followed shortly after for a duck. When Ravindra Jadeja Angkrish Raghuvanshi (10) and Rovman Powell (23) snared in their own net, finishing with 2/8 as KKR were reduced to 85/6 in 13.3 overs.
With 71 runs required off the last 39 balls and only the bowlers left to watch, Rajasthan Royals looked definite favourites. But Rinku Singhthe designated finisher of this generation had other plans. Rinku anchored the innings with 53 off 34 balls, hitting 5 fours and 2 sixes.
The turning point was the 7th wicket partnership between Rinku and Anukul Roy. Playing the role of the aggressor, Anukul made a cameo century, blasting 29 off just 16 deliveries. The pair went on to score 76 runs unbeaten in record time. Needing 6 runs in the final over, Rinku displayed his trademark calmness Brijesh Sharma Through the gaps to seal victory at 161/6.
